Meteora is a UNESCO World Heritage Site located in central Greece. It is famous for its stunning monasteries, which are perched on top of towering rock formations. Gallipoli is a town in northwestern Turkey. It is known for its historical significance as the site of the Gallipoli Campaign during World War I.

Best time to go
The best time to visit Meteora is during the spring or fall. The weather is mild during these seasons, and the crowds are smaller. The best time to visit Gallipoli is during the summer. The weather is warm and sunny during this season, and the beaches are open.

Where to Go
There are many things to see and do in Meteora and Gallipoli. Here are a few of the most popular attractions:
- Meteora: The Monasteries of Meteora, the Varlaam Monastery, and the Great Meteoron Monastery.
- Gallipoli: The Gallipoli Peninsula National Park, the Anzac Cove, and the Lone Pine Cemetery.
